Thumbnail 1696926
thumbnail
Large (256x256)

Articles

‘It’s Israeli policy’: Report reveals abuse of Palestinians in prisons
Physicians for Human Rights-Israel reveals torture, abuse carried out against Palestinians held in Israeli prisons.
1